What is a Ground Bean Coffee Machine?
A Ground Bean Coffee Machine, frequently referred to as a coffee grinder, is a device designed to grind whole coffee beans into the desired coarseness required for developing. These machines can differ substantially in style, performance, and capacity, catering to different developing approaches, such as espresso, drip coffee, French press, and more.

Utilizing a ground bean coffee machine is reasonably simple, but it's important to focus on specific factors for ideal outcomes. Here's a step-by-step guide:
Choose Quality Beans: Start with premium, freshly roasted coffee beans.Select Grind Size: Adjust your grinder according to your developing technique. Coarseness for French press, medium for drip, and fine for espresso.Measure Beans: Use a scale or determining spoon to ensure the correct amount of beans for your desired cup.Grind: Activate the grinder and enable it to run till the beans reach the wanted fineness.Brew Immediately: Use the ground coffee right away for the Best Bean To Cup Coffee Machine Under £500 taste. Tidy up: Empty any leftover premises from the grinder to avoid stale flavors in future brews.Upkeep Tips for Ground Bean Coffee Machines
To take full advantage of the lifespan and performance of ground bean coffee machines, routine upkeep is vital:
Regular Cleaning: Depending on usage, tidy the grinder at least once a week. Utilize a soft brush to get rid of coffee residues.Deep Cleaning: Every few months, disassemble your grinder (if relevant) and clean the components with warm water. Ensure all parts are dry before reassembly.Inspect for Wear and Tear: Monitor for any irregular noises or changes in efficiency, which might indicate needed repairs or replacements.Shop Properly: Keep your grinder in a cool, dry location to prevent wetness build-up and protect the motor's longevity.Popular Ground Bean Coffee Machine Brands

Q: What grind size must I use?A: The
grind size depends on your developing technique. Coarse for French press, medium for drip coffee, and fine for espresso.

Q: Can I grind other things in my coffee grinder?A: While some grinders can handle spices or grains, it's advised to utilize devoted grinders for non-coffee products to avoid taste contamination. Q: How long do coffee mills last?A: With appropriate maintenance,great quality grinders can last numerous
years. Electrical parts might use out sooner, so be watchful of any modifications in performance. Q: Is a burr grinder actually worth the investment?A: For coffee enthusiasts, purchasing a burr
